Questions and Answers

What is required before digging fence post holes?

You must contact Alabama 811 for a utility locate. Hitting a gas, water, or fiber line in Holtville Center is a major financial and safety liability. The service marks public lines; private lines require a private locate. Concurrently, file for a permit with the Holtville permit office. Starting work without both is illegal and dangerous.

How do you build a fence to survive high winds?

The 115 MPH V-ult wind speed dictates the structure. This engineering standard from ASCE 7-22 requires closer post spacing (often 6 feet on-center), deeper footings, and wind-rated brackets. In Holtville Center, open exposure from AL-143 increases load. Proper design prevents panels from becoming projectiles during the peak storm season.

Can I have a smart gate with a pool?

Yes, with specific integration. The 2021 ISPSC requires a 48-inch barrier with a self-closing, self-latching gate. Smart IoT latches must automatically engage and provide a tamper alert. This meets modern liability standards in Alabama by ensuring the gate never remains accidentally open, blending the low-to-moderate smart-gate trend with mandatory safety.

Why must fence posts in Holtville be set so deep?

The frost line in Holtville Center is 12 inches. Posts set above this depth risk frost heave, where frozen soil expansion pushes them upward, causing failure. IRC R403.1.4 requires footings below the frost line. For a 115 MPH V-ult wind rating, posts also need deep concrete footings to resist overturning forces from storms common from March to May.

What fence materials work best for Holtville's conditions?

Material compatibility is critical. The very heavy termite risk rules out untreated wood in ground contact. Use pressure-treated, termite-resistant lumber or composite. Moderate soil corrosivity requires h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ks. Aluminum or vinyl are durable, low-maintenance options that resist both corrosion and insect damage.
